Top Christmas Flowering Plants Native to Australia
Australia’s unique flora offers several stunning flowering plants perfect for Christmas displays. Native species like the Christmas Bush (Ceratopetalum gudgeonii) burst with bright red flowers, symbolizing the season. Alongside, exotic cultivars such as Poinsettias, Amaryllis, and Kalanchoe thrive indoors with proper care, delivering rich colors and long-lasting blooms that perfectly complement festive decor.
Indoor Flowering Plants Perfect for Christmas Decor
For houseplant lovers, selecting Christmas-ready flowering species ensures your home glows with seasonal charm. Poinsettias are iconic, with their bold bracts in crimson and green, ideal for window sills. Amaryllis offers large, elegant flowers in vibrant reds and whites, blooming from late autumn into winter. Kalanchoe adds texture with clusters of tiny blooms, thriving in indoor warmth and bright light, making it a low-maintenance yet eye-catching choice for festive arrangements.
Caring for Christmas Flowers in Australian Homes
To maximize flowering success, match plant needs with your home environment. Most Christmas blooms prefer bright, indirect light and well-draining soil. Water consistently but avoid waterlogging, especially during cooler months. Maintain moderate humidity and temperatures between 16–20°C for optimal blooming. Fertilize lightly every 4–6 weeks during the season to support vibrant flowers. With these simple steps, your Christmas plants will thrive and bring joy throughout the holidays.
